Orthopaedics is a branch of surgery which focuses on the study of the musculoskeletal system including bones, joints, ligaments, tendons, and muscles. It deals with both the prevention and treatment of injuries, deformities, and diseases affecting this bone system. MS (Master of Surgery) in Orthopaedics is a postgraduate degree that allows medical professionals to become Orthopaedic surgeons.
